Official TV Channels for World Cup 2026 in USA
FOX holds the English-language broadcast rights for the USA. FOX will air 70 matches free over the air, including every USMNT game, the opening match, every Round of 16 game onward, and the final. FS1 picks up the remaining 34 matches, mostly from the group stage and Round of 32. Both channels are free with a basic cable or satellite package, and FOX is free with a TV antenna.
On the Spanish side, Telemundo is the home of World Cup 2026. Telemundo broadcasts 92 matches free over the air in Spanish, making it the single biggest broadcaster of the tournament in the USA. Universo, also from NBCUniversal, carries the other 12 matches. Between Telemundo and FOX, every one of the 104 matches is available to watch for free if you have an antenna. How to Watch World Cup 2026 for Free in USA
An antenna is the best free option. Plug one into your TV and you get FOX (70 matches in English) and Telemundo (92 matches in Spanish) at no cost whatsoever. If your local signal is weak, a basic amplified antenna from any electronics store fixes that in minutes. You will catch every USMNT game and the entire knockout stage on FOX without paying a cent.
Tubi is also streaming two matches for free. The opening ceremony and Mexico vs South Africa on June 11 plus USA vs Paraguay on June 12 will be live on Tubi at no cost and with no subscription required. Just download the Tubi app or visit tubi.tv. The USA vs Paraguay game being free on Tubi is a big deal for fans who do not yet have a setup ready.

Watch World Cup 2026 Without Cable
Several streaming services carry the channels you need. FOX One is the standout option for English-only fans who want all 104 matches and 4K streaming in one place. The table below shows your main choices at a glance.
| Service | Channels | Price | Free Trial |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| FOX One | FOX, FS1, FS2, FOX Deportes | $19.99/mo or $199.99/yr | 7 days | All 104 matches, 4K streaming, no cable needed |
| Peacock | Telemundo, Universo | $7.99/mo | None | All 104 matches in Spanish, on-demand replays |
| YouTube TV | FOX, FS1, Telemundo | ~$72.99/mo | 21 days | Unlimited cloud DVR, strong app across all devices |
| Hulu + Live TV | FOX, FS1, Telemundo | ~$82.99/mo | 3 days | Disney+ and ESPN+ included in bundle |
| fuboTV | FOX, FS1, Universo | ~$84.99/mo | 7 days | No Telemundo since Nov 21, 2025. Use Peacock for Spanish. |
| Sling Blue | FOX, FS1 | ~$40/mo | None | No free trial. First month 50% off. FOX varies by market. |
FOX One is the cleanest all-in-one option for cord-cutters who want every match in English plus 4K. At $19.99 per month, it is cheaper than most live TV bundles and gives you a 7-day free trial. If you only care about Spanish coverage, Peacock at $7.99 per month is the best value by far. YouTube TV and Hulu + Live TV are solid choices if you already use them for other sports, since both carry FOX, FS1, and Telemundo. Sling Blue is the budget pick but check whether FOX is available in your market before signing up.

Watch World Cup 2026 in Spanish in USA
Telemundo is broadcasting 92 matches free over the air, making it the go-to for Spanish-speaking fans. Universo handles the remaining 12 matches. If you have an antenna, you get Telemundo for free. Peacock streams all 104 matches live in Spanish at $7.99 per month, which is the best streaming deal for complete Spanish coverage.
One important note: fuboTV lost all NBCUniversal channels, including Telemundo and Universo, on November 21, 2025. If you are a fuboTV subscriber and want Spanish coverage, you will need to add Peacock separately. YouTube TV and Hulu + Live TV still carry Telemundo in most markets. Always check your local market when signing up to confirm channel availability.
FIFA World Cup 2026 Radio Coverage in USA
Univision Radio and SiriusXM will provide Spanish and English radio coverage of the 2026 World Cup. SiriusXM carries live match commentary across multiple channels during major tournaments and is available via the SiriusXM app on iOS and Android. Univision Radio covers the matches in Spanish on its network of stations and through the Uforia app, which is free to download.

USMNT World Cup Matches & When to Watch
The USA plays all three group stage games on home soil. Two matches are at SoFi Stadium in Inglewood, California, and one is at Lumen Field in Seattle. All three air live on FOX in English and Telemundo in Spanish. Here is the full USMNT group stage schedule.
| Date | Match | Time (ET) | Time (PT) | TV Channel | Venue |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Friday, June 12 | USA vs Paraguay | 9:00 PM | 6:00 PM | FOX / Telemundo | SoFi Stadium, Inglewood, CA |
| Thursday, June 19 | USA vs Australia | 3:00 PM | 12:00 PM | FOX / Telemundo | Lumen Field, Seattle, WA |
| Thursday, June 25 | USA vs Türkiye | 10:00 PM | 7:00 PM | FOX / Telemundo | SoFi Stadium, Inglewood, CA |

Can I watch the World Cup in 4K in the USA?
Yes. FOX One streams all 104 matches live in 4K. You need a 4K-compatible TV and a stable internet connection. FOX’s over-the-air broadcast is in 1080i HD. FOX One is the only confirmed source for 4K streaming in the USA for World Cup 2026.
Can I watch World Cup 2026 if I am traveling outside the USA?
US streaming apps like FOX One and Peacock are geo-locked to the USA. If you travel abroad during the tournament, you will need a VPN to access them. Can I watch World Cup 2026 on my PlayStation or Xbox?
Yes. FOX One is available on Xbox. The Peacock and YouTube TV apps are available on PlayStation 4 and PlayStation 5. The Tubi app also works on PlayStation and Xbox consoles, giving you access to the two free-streamed matches at no cost.
Are World Cup matches available on demand after they air?
Yes. FOX One offers on-demand replays of all matches. Peacock also has on-demand Spanish replays. If you miss a USMNT game live, you can catch the full replay on FOX One within a few hours of the final whistle.
What happens to USMNT matches if they advance past the group stage?
Every match from the Round of 16 onward airs on FOX, not FS1. So if the USMNT advances, their knockout stage games are free to watch on FOX over the air. The knockout stage schedule will be updated with confirmed match times as teams advance.
